The Chinese idiom 「所向無前」 we’re introducing today is explained in detail below, along with its meaning and usage.
Direction: refers to the place where the army is heading. Wherever the army pointed, there was no obstacle.
The Mandarin pronunciation of this idiom is :
suǒ xiàng wú qián
while its Cantonese pinyin is :
so2 heung3 mou4 chin4
